Governor Darius Ishaku has disclose that Women empowerment programs remain key to sustainable development.

The Governor stated this during the flag off and distribution of livelihood grants to Women affinity groups at the gymnasium hall of the Jolly Nyame Stadium Jalingo.

“My administration has empowered many Women from all parts of the State who have trained others to be self-reliant.

According to him, the Nigeria for Women Program was designed to improve the living condition of Women in the Country which Taraba State is among the benefiting six States of the federation.

The Governor promised to leverage on the successes recorded by the affinity Women groups who have so far contributed over three hundred million naira for the program.

“Let me appreciated the Federal Government, World bank and the State Coordinating unit over the success of the program and charged the recipients of the grants to ensure that they keep to their grant agreement.

Commenting, Chairman of the State steering Committee who is the Deputy Governor of the State Haruna Manu thanked Governor Darius Ishaku for providing counterpart fund of two hundred million naira for the Nigeria for Women Program.

The Chairman disclosed that the Nigeria for Women Project is a program designed to support women from age eighteen and above in three local government areas of the State which include Zing, Bali and Takum.

In her remarks, the National Project Coordinator of the Nigeria for Women Program Ruth Mshelia appreciated Governor Darius Ishaku for creating the enabling environment for the program to succeed in Taraba State.

She commended the Women for their resilience during various their various trainings.

Also in his remarks, the Representative of the team leader of the World bank Ibrahim Umar Ali congratulated the State Government for being the second State that has met their needs.

Some of the beneficiaries who spoke at the function thanked Governor Darius Ishaku for his magnanimity in supporting the program.

High point of the Program was the presentation of cheques to the affinity groups in Takum of over three hundred and ninety million naira, Bali over one hundred and forty five million naira, Zing over two hundred and fifty three million naira while individuals received alert of sixty thousand naira each immediately.
